I own a fender strat ultra in Texas Tea but after I bought a new AO60s tele in burgundy mist around New Years, I barely played it. A few weeks back I found a brand new AO50 tele which I went and bought to finish my 50s-60s tele collection. Now the ultra strat did nothing but gathering dust. Which is weird as I think it's a fantastic looking and playing guitar!

However, something about these american original series got to me! The vibe, the feels, the custom-shop-like specs, ... So I went looking for a 60s strat. A 50s was fine too but I only wanted the white blonde American Original (or AVII in Vintage blonde but I do prefer 9.5 radius). None to be found anywhere.

However, a big store went out of business a while back and recently held an auction to sell the remaining stock. There was 1 American Original in that auction, which happened to be the white blonde AO50s strat. I bid and got it brand new for €1200 (excluding taxes that is). Seems like a good deal to begin with + I can't find them anywhere anymore.

My ultra is now officially for sale. I'm still looking for a 60s strat to complete my 50s-60s tele/strat "collection" but I absolutely want it to be in Burgundy Mist which just isn't an option for now... I'm secretly hoping the AVII 1961 strat gets released in that colour!

Yesterday, after thinking about that color a little bit more, I went ahead and ordered a couple of cans of Mohawk Toner - one can of "White-Wash" and one can of "Antique White" toner

I've used Mohawk Toner in the "Blond" color before, and it does a great looking Butterscotch Blond color, but this time I'm looking for more of a White Blond color

I'm getting ready to do a White Blond hard-tailed Strat build using an unusual one-piece Swamp Ash blank

I'm going with the big and deep body contours that some of the earlier Stratocasters had, and I'm thinking about using a big piece of quartersawn Pau Ferro that I have to build the vintage-style one-piece neck

The Mohawk Toners are a diluted lacquer mixture that allow you to put on very light coats of transparent color and gradually build them up to reach your preferred degree of color
